The MTTR Challenge
Traditional incident management relies heavily on manual processes. When an alert fires, an engineer must investigate, correlate with other signals, identify the root cause, and implement a fix. In complex distributed systems, this process can take hours or even days.
The challenge is compounded by alert fatigue. Modern infrastructure generates thousands of alerts per day, many of which are duplicates, false positives, or symptoms of a single underlying issue. Without intelligent correlation, teams waste valuable time chasing the wrong signals.
How AI-Powered Correlation Works
Intelligent incident correlation uses machine learning algorithms to automatically group related alerts based on:
- Temporal Correlation: Alerts that fire within a similar time window are likely related
- Topological Correlation: Alerts from interconnected systems often share a common cause
- Historical Pattern Matching: Similar alert patterns from past incidents inform current diagnosis
- Causal Analysis: AI identifies which alert is the cause vs. which are symptoms

Implementation Best Practices
To maximize the impact of AI-powered incident correlation:
- Start with clean data: Ensure your monitoring tools are generating meaningful, well-labeled alerts
- Map your topology: The more the system understands about your infrastructure relationships, the better the correlation
- Train with historical data: Feed past incident data to improve pattern recognition
- Iterate and refine: Continuously review correlation accuracy and adjust thresholds
